On the afternoon of September 30, 1982, in the rural area of Sugarbush, Minnesota, three-year-old Kevin Jay Ayotte vanished from his family's summer home. A male toddler with blond hair and blue eyes, Kevin was playing upstairs with his older brother when his mother briefly stepped outside. When she returned, Kevin was gone.
